Bahrain: LMRA chief urges volunteering in vaccine trial

Chief Executive Officer of the Labour Market Regulatory Authority (LMRA), Ausamah Abdulla Al-Absi, has stressed the importance of supporting the efforts of the National Medical Taskforce for Combating the Coronavirus (COVID-19), noting that taking part in the vaccine trial is necessary in order to ensure reaching a secure vaccine as soon as possible.

In a statement to the Bahrain News Agency (BNA), Al-Absi said that the whole world is waiting eagerly for a solution to COVID-19 in order to restore the pre-pandemic life, noting that this cannot be achieved only through the participation of the citizens and residents in phase III clinical trial for a COVID-19 inactivated vaccine, conducted under the supervision of a specialised medical staff.

He emphasised that everyone is responsible for reaching a successful vaccine that would benefit the entire humanity.

He pointed out that his participation has encouraged many LMRA officials and directors to volunteer, adding that taking the candidate vaccine is a national duty.

He affirmed that the vaccine is secure and procedures are clear, paying tribute to the medical staff working at the Bahrain International Exhibition and Convention Centre for the tremendous humanitarian efforts they are making.
